+package org.usfirst.frc.team4272.robotlib;
+
+import edu.wpi.first.wpilibj.SerialPort;
+import edu.wpi.first.wpilibj.SerialPort.Port;
+//Warning: if the pixy is plugged in through mini usb, this code WILL NOT WORK b/c the pixy is smart and detects where it should send data
+public class Pixy {
+ SerialPort pixy;
+ Port port = Port.kMXP;
+ PixyPacket[] packets;
+ PixyException pExc;
+ String print;
+ public Pixy() {
+ pixy = new SerialPort(19200, port);
+ pixy.setReadBufferSize(14);
+ packets = new PixyPacket[7];
+ pExc = new PixyException(print);
+ }
+//This method parses raw data from the pixy into readable integers
+ public int cvt(byte upper, byte lower) {
+ return (((int)upper & 0xff) << 8) | ((int)lower & 0xff);
+ }
+
+ public void pixyReset(){
+ pixy.reset();
+ }
+
+//This method gathers data, then parses that data, and assigns the ints to global variables
+ public PixyPacket readPacket(int Signature) throws PixyException {
+ int Checksum;
+ int Sig;
+ byte[] rawData = new byte[32];
+ try{
+ rawData = pixy.read(32);
+ } catch (RuntimeException e){
+ }
+ if(rawData.length < 32){
+ System.out.println("byte array length is broken");
+ return null;
+ }
+ for (int i = 0; i <= 16; i++) {
+ int syncWord = cvt(rawData[i+1], rawData[i+0]); //Parse first 2 bytes
+ if (syncWord == 0xaa55) { //Check is first 2 bytes equal a "sync word", which indicates the start of a packet of valid data
+ syncWord = cvt(rawData[i+3], rawData[i+2]); //Parse the next 2 bytes
+ if (syncWord != 0xaa55){ //Shifts everything in the case that one syncword is sent
+ i -= 2;
+ }
+//This next block parses the rest of the data
+ Checksum = cvt(rawData[i+5], rawData[i+4]);
+ Sig = cvt(rawData[i+7], rawData[i+6]);
+ if(Sig <= 0 || Sig > packets.length){
+ break;
+ }
+ packets[Sig - 1] = new PixyPacket();
+ packets[Sig - 1].X = cvt(rawData[i+9], rawData[i+8]);
+ packets[Sig - 1].Y = cvt(rawData[i+11], rawData[i+10]);
+ packets[Sig - 1].Width = cvt(rawData[i+13], rawData[i+12]);
+ packets[Sig - 1].Height = cvt(rawData[i+15], rawData[i+14]);
+//Checks whether the data is valid using the checksum *This if block should never be entered*
+ if (Checksum != Sig + packets[Sig - 1].X + packets[Sig - 1].Y + packets[Sig - 1].Width + packets[Sig - 1].Height) {
+ packets[Sig - 1] = null;
+ throw pExc;
+ }
+ break;
+ }
+ }
+//Assigns our packet to a temp packet, then deletes data so that we dont return old data
+ PixyPacket pkt = packets[Signature - 1];
+ packets[Signature - 1] = null;
+ return pkt;
+ }
+} \ No newline at end of file
